Runtogen offers a broad portfolio of stable cell lines engineered for consistent and long-term overexpression of target genes. These models are optimized for functional research, protein production, and screening.

Each cell line is validated for expression stability, phenotypic consistency, and quality control, providing reproducible platforms for translational research and therapeutic discovery.
